6-6-187
Section 6-6-187 Subjecting unpaid subscriptions to satisfy payment of judgment against corporation. A judgment creditor of a corporation, having an execution returned, "no property found," may, by complaint in a court of competent jurisdiction, subject to the payment of his judgment the unpaid subscription of one or more stockholders in such corporation without joining the other stockholders and without regard to whether the corporation has called for such subscription or could commence an action therefor against the stockholder. (Code 1896, §823; Code 1907, §3744; Code 1923, §7347; Code 1940, T. 7, §902.)...

36-22-14
Section 36-22-14 Conveyance of money subject to further order or judgment of court to successor by sheriff upon expiration of official term. The sheriff having in his hands at the expiration of his official term any money held by him subject to the further order or judgment of any court shall, on the demand of his successor in office, pay the same to him and on such payment shall be discharged from further liability therefor. (Code 1876, §738; Code 1886, §818; Code 1896, §3748; Code 1907, §5880; Code 1923, §10206; Code 1940, T. 54, §26.)...

27-32-36
Section 27-32-36 Assessments - Order to pay - Judgment. (a) Upon the return day of the order to show cause provided for in Section 27-32-34, if the member or subscriber does not appear and serve duly verified objections upon the commissioner, the court shall make an order adjudging that such member or subscriber is liable for the amount of the assessment against him, together with costs, and that the commissioner may have judgment against the member or subscriber therefor. (b) If, on such return date, the member or subscriber appears and serves duly verified objections upon the commissioner, there shall be a full hearing before the court, which, after such hearing, shall make such order as the facts shall warrant. (c) Any such order shall have the same force and effect, shall be entered and docketed and may be appealed from as if it were a judgment in an original action brought in the court in which the proceeding is pending. (Acts 1971, No. 407, p. 707, §655.)...

8-3-40
Section 8-3-40 Transfer of judgment to surety upon payment of same by surety. (a) Whenever a judgment is obtained by a creditor on a demand to which there are one or more sureties, the sureties may pay such demand, and the same shall be transferred by operation of law to the surety or sureties paying or satisfying such demand, who shall have all the liens or equities of such judgment and of the debt or claim on which the same is founded. (b) The plaintiff in the judgment, his agent or attorney of record, when the payment is made, must assign such judgment to the surety or sureties paying the money, who may collect the same, with interest and costs, in the name of the plaintiff for their use, and may assert any lien or right against the principal debtor which the plaintiff could have asserted if the debt had not been paid. (Code 1852, §2651; Code 1867, §3078; Code 1876, §3418; Code 1886, §3157; Code 1896, §3888; Code 1907, §5408; Code 1923, §9567; Code 1940, T. 9, §101.)...
